Maya Hawke, the daughter of renowned actors Uma Thurman and Ethan Hawke, inherited more than just their last name. She's also become a celebrated actress in her own right. During an interview, she made it clear that she's comfortable using the privileges bestowed upon her by her famous parents.

Nepo babies - a term used for children of celebrities who rely on their parents' fame for success in the entertainment industry - are a hot topic in recent years. The conversation about whether these individuals deserve their achievements without the help of nepotism isn't dying down either.

Maya Hawke doesn't mind being classified as a "nepo baby." In fact, she's proud of her famous parents and the advantages that come with it. In an interview with "The Times," she expressed her contentment with her background and said, "There are so many people who deserve this kind of life but can't have it. But I think I'm happy not to deserve it and still do it." She noted that not only would it benefit her, but also help others.

During her fledgling years in the acting world, she weighed her options: "when I started, I saw two ways: Change your name, get a nose job, and go to open casting roles," said Hawke. She ultimately chose to embrace her well-known last name, which opened many doors for her. She can live with the teasing. "It's a great place. My relationship with my parents is really honest and positive, and that's more than anyone can say about it."

The Proud "Nepo-Dad"

In 2022, Maya Hawke even collaborated with her father on the biographical drama "Wildcat." Her director? None other than Ethan Hawke. She joked in the same interview with "The Times" that she had tried to address her father as "Ethan" on set, but eventually gave in and called him "Papa." "We were both constantly asked if we were nervous working together, but we weren't nervous because I've spent my whole life making art with this guy."

Ethan Hawke, who has enjoyed a long and successful career in Hollywood, has also embraced his "nepo" status. In 2023, he told "Variety," "Simply put, I'm a nepo dad! And I'm not ashamed of it." Among his notable roles are those in "The Dead Poets Society" (1989) and "Training Day" (2001). He was married to Tarantino muse Uma Thurman (the "Pulp Fiction" and "Kill Bill" star) from 1998 to 2005, with whom he also shares another son, Levon Hawke, who is also an actor.
